Smoke Eel is a refined Rauchbier that showcases a unique artisanal process, utilizing Bruun malt smoked for a full week in a traditional eel smokehouse. This creates a sophisticated sensory profile that balances a deep amber, coppery-brown appearance with a nuanced aromatic depth. On the nose, subtle woody smoke mingles with a toasty, malty-sweet foundation. The palate reveals a harmonious integration of clean lager fermentation and rich maltiness, where the smoke adds a gentle savory touch without overpowering the base beer. Designed for accessibility, it offers a smooth, medium-bodied mouthfeel and a clean, medium-dry finish that invites both novices and aficionados to enjoy its delicate character.
Appearance.Deep amber to coppery-brown in color with excellent clarity. Renders a large, creamy, rich tan head with good retention and light lacing.
Aroma.Moderate intensity featuring a balanced blend of woody, clean smoke and rich, toasty malt. The smoke character is subtle and well-integrated with notes of bread crust and toasted grain. Clean lager fermentation profile with no esters or diacetyl.
Taste.Initial impression is malty-sweet and toasty, followed by a refined, clean smoke flavor that reflects the eel smokehouse origin. The malt richness is supportive, not cloying, balanced by a moderate hop bitterness. The finish is medium-dry with a lingering, savory smoke aftertaste. No harsh, phenolic, or acrid qualities are present.
Mouthfeel.Medium body with a smooth, well-conditioned lager character. Moderate to medium-high carbonation. Displays a clean mouthfeel without astringency or significant alcohol warmth.
